Welcome, plugin folks! Before your Glintly plugin can ship strings, run our extraction script, `strex`, against your source tree — it pulls every translatable string into a catalog the Lumora translators can use. First run needs the signing vault unlocked, though. Grab the catalog template, run `strex init`, and when prompted, enter the recovery passphrase, which is:

unlock words, kajef-kadug: sorys-pelax-lamael-tamvan-briiel-novdor-fenwyn-tamdor-oliion-keleth-julok-belion-ralok

Step 7: Enable EXIF scrubbing

Heads up — the new Pixelmoor upload path strips EXIF data before anything hits storage, so the old post-processing scrubber can be retired. Flip the flag only after the media workers are on version 3.2, or uploads will double-process and slow to a crawl. Once you've confirmed worker versions, apply the scrubber configuration shown below.

settings of fajop-fahap:
[holeth]
port = 9300
team = juleth
host = holeth.tolvaqsoft.example
region = south-4
access_code = ac_4bcdf6
timeout_ms = 500

Runbook — clock skew on Bramley CI build agents. Symptom: signed artifacts rejected, timestamps out of order in logs. Check the sync daemon on the affected agent first; restart it, wait two minutes, re-run the canary build. If skew exceeds five seconds across the fleet, drain agents and escalate to Toove infra. The skew thresholds and sync sources are defined in these settings.

config for haweg-bagag:
[kasath]
host = kasath.qirvancorp.internal
user = kasath_svc
database = kasath_prod

## ScanBridge Onboarding — Signing

ScanBridge handles barcode scanner input for the Kestrel warehouse app. Firmware bundles pushed to scanners must be signed or devices refuse the update. Build with `make bundle`, sign, then push via the fleet console. Unsigned pushes brick nothing but waste a truck roll. For this week's builds, sign with the key below.

deploy key for tajep-fahif: bky19_Hsbh6jHLfHtPXqpEhcy